The Lie Group Structure of Elliptic/Hyperelliptic Functions

arXiv:2211.06183

Abstract

We consider the generalized dual transformation for elliptic/hyperelliptic functions up to genus three. For the genus one case, from the algebraic addition formula, we deduce that the Weierstrass function has the SO(2,1) Sp(2,)/ Lie group structure. For the genus two case, by constructing a quadratic invariant form, we find that hyperelliptic functions have the SO(3,2) Sp(4,)/ Lie group structure. Making use of quadratic invariant forms reveals that hyperelliptic functions with genus three have the SO(9,6) Lie group and/or it's subgroup structure.
